This issue has occurred since the last UI 6.1 update, my unit is an A34 5G variant and ever since the update I've tried everything from resetting the cache partitions on the recovery mode, reset my phone but to no avail. I've researched about this issue and found out that this only happened on phones that have aftermarket screens and that the best option is either to replace the screen (which worked on one user) or to downgrade my phone—but there is the risk of bricking my phone.

A technician told me however that it is best to wait for the next update if I don't want to get pricey on having to use my Samsung again. So I waited. Unfortunately, after the UI 7.0 update nothing changed I still cannot use the touch feature. Btw, I also tried updating the touch firmware (the TSP thing) and have found out that the phone does not recognize the touch firmware of my screen for some reason(either it was deleted in the update or the update it self don't recognize it anymore as it says N/A where it shouldn't be).

Anyways I brought it over to a technician and I was once again faced with the same two options. Now, do I really have to replace the screen or once again, wait for the next update hoping for the issue to be fixed? Or is there any other way to resolve this issue?
